Salma Hayek Freezes Breast Milk

Salma Hayek is using an "industrial-size breast pump" to lose her baby
weight, it has been claimed.

The 'Frida' actress, who gave birth to her first child Valentina Paloma last
September, is resorting to extreme measures after friends told her
breastfeeding is the best way to shed post-pregnancy pounds.

A friend of the actress said: "Salma has been pumping and freezing endless
amounts of breast milk. When she's not feeding Valentina, she's hooked up to
an industrial-size breast pump."

However, the 41-year-old actress is not having much luck reclaiming the sexy
figure that made her famous.

The friend added to America's Star magazine: "Whatever she does, she still
can't drop the extra pounds."

Lactation expert Susan Condon has warned Salma not to push her body and try
to lose weight too quickly.

She said: "After you have your baby, if what you eat is varied and well
balanced, breastfeeding can help you lose your pregnancy weight without
compromising either your health or your baby's by dieting. And you naturally
burn calories to make breast milk every time you nurse.

"The best way of losing weight is to work toward a gradual weight loss, eat
when you're hungry, and make sure you get enough fluids. It's the best way
of losing weight easily and safely!"
